We all think we know who Marie Sklodowska was. Also known as Marie Curie, she was the first woman to receive a Nobel Prize and the first female scientist to be universally recognized: her discovery of radioactivity was the beginning of a brilliant career that culminated in the addition of two new elements to the periodic table. A tireless worker, Marie Curie seemed oblivious to the limitations imposed on women of her time. The reality, however, is that she was despised and attacked: she was branded an impostor, a Jewish immigrant, an adulteress, an opportunist... This fascinating biography will allow us to discover with new eyes the life of an extraordinary scientist who, even today, continues to arouse immense appeal.
